Hawaii County firefighters end search for missing opihi picker

Hawaii county firefighters ended the search for a 30-year-old man who was last seen picking opihi Thursday.

Seven Big Island firefighters used off road vehicles and all terrain vehicles to comb the shoreline fronting the Kapoho lighthouse on Monday.

Peter Mahoe was last seen between noon and 2 p.m., climbing down a cliff face. The Coast Guard reported that Mahoe’s all-terrain vehicle was found 200 feet from the area he was last seen. His family was also camping close by.

The Coast Guard, Hawaii Fire Department and Hawaii Police Department conducted an intensive search spanning 1,414 square miles. The Coast Guard suspended its search on Sunday evening after failing to locate any sign of Mahoe.

Hawaii County search and rescue crews ended the search Monday night after finding no sign of Mahoe along the shoreline and ocean at Cape Kumukahi area.
